This painting by Charles William Wyllie depicts the Angel pub in #Rotherhithe, South #London (c.1887) [101 #Bermondsey Wall E, #London #SE16]. Like many riverside pubs, it was a den of cut-throats & press gangs. It sits on what was once the manor house of King Edward III (1300s).
